| Company | Timeline | Status | |
| Arcadis LLP Non-designated LLP Member • Unreported | 5 Sep 2014←2 Years 3 Months→16 Dec 2016 | Active | |
Christal Cost Management LLP Designated LLP Member • Unreported | 26 Sep 2012←2 Years 9 Months→7 Jul 2015 | Dissolved | |
| Newbury Racecourse Management Limited Director • Director | 6 Sep 2012←1 Year 9 Months→1 Jul 2014 | Active | |
| Christal Construction Management Limited Director • Project Management | 8 Sep 2006←8 Years→1 Jan 2015 | Dissolved | |
